@mmmsted, Pagosa Spring is at 7000 feet ?
Ouch !

Remember that, for every 1000 feet of altitude, you're loosing, on average, 3.5 degree F.

So, climbing to 7000 feet, it will be about 25F cooler.

That is why, I think, the best for now is to stay where it is warmer, that is a bit more south, because it is lower in altitude.

North of Arizona stands at 8000 feet, while the south is at 1000 feet. That is a 25 F difference. For a guy sleeping in a tent, it makes a difference.

It's like in summer, when you are at the base of mont washington. 78F, in T-Shirt and shorts, life is good.
You're climbing at the summit (or take the road for the top) and there, it is 45-50, and with the wind factor, you're freezing.
